Steven Spielberg is described as one of the most powerful and influential personalities in the history of film. As a director, he is the most successful of all time.
From an early age, Spielberg showed exceptional talents as an imaginative young boy with a great passion for the arts. As a child he earned the nickname Cecil B. Spielberg, when he began charging his friends and family to view his home movies. By the age of 12, Spielberg was already visualizing him receiving an Oscar and began rehearsing his acceptance speech.
Spielberg journeyed to that Oscar he envisioned, asking for help and mentoring from famous actors and top directors along the way. He knew that in order to be the best, he would have to learn from the best. Spielberg found success in his unique ability to bring life to the stories we all love on the big screen.
He has directed some of the world’s most loved and quoted movies, including E.T., The Color Purple, Jurassic Park, Schindler’s List and Saving Private Ryan, among others.
Spielberg's talents and abilities teamed with a passion and commitment to his career has made him the most powerful filmmaker in the world.

It was a busy morning, approximately 8:30 am, when an elderly gentleman in his 80’s, arrived to have stitches removed from his thumb. He stated that he was in a hurry as he had an appointment at 9:00 am. I took his vital signs and had him take a seat, knowing it would be over an hour before someone would be able to see him. I saw him looking at his watch and decided, since I was not busy with another patient, I would evaluate his wound.
It was well healed so I talked to one of the doctors, got the needed supplies to remove his sutures and redress his wound. While taking care of his wound, we began to engage in conversation. I asked him if he had a doctor’s appointment this morning, as he was in such hurry. The gentleman told me no and that he needed to go to the nursing home to eat breakfast with his wife. I then inquired as to her health. He told me that she had been there for a while and that she was a victim of Alzheimer Disease. As we talked and I finished dressing his wound, I asked if she would be worried if he was a bit late.
He replied that she no longer knew who he was, that she had not recognized him in five years now. I was surprised and asked him, “And you still go every morning, even though she doesn’t know who you are?” He smiled as he patted my hand and said, “She doesn’t know me but I still know who she is.” I had to hold back tears as he left, I had goose bumps on my arm and thought, “That this is the kind of love I want in my life.”
